Role Overview
The Property & Client Services Coordinator is the operational backbone of the center, driving administrative excellence across contracts, finance, compliance, and tenant coordination. Reporting directly to the General Manager, this role ensures accuracy, efficiency, and compliance across critical day-to-day functions that support the overall success of the property.
What You’ll Own
Contract & Procurement Operations
- Maintain and manage the Center Contract Log, tracking all agreements and amendments
- Draft and process service contracts, work orders, and change orders
- Support vendor bidding and contract lifecycle through Procore
- Ensure adherence to procurement policies and financial authorization guidelines
- Participate in vendor/project meetings and track follow-ups
Financial & Administrative Operations
- Own accounts payable processing: invoice matching, routing, and issue resolution
- Manage vendor setup and maintenance requests to ensure timely payment
- Process and audit manual billings across departments (legal, specialty leasing, etc.)
- Maintain check logs and coordinate lockbox submissions
- Reconcile P-Card expenses monthly and track supporting documentation
- Support quarterly accruals and forecasting alongside leadership
Risk, Compliance & Access Management
- Coordinate and issue work/access permits for vendors and contractors
- Ensure all contractors meet insurance and compliance requirements
- Support compliance workflows using systems like Sine/Angus
- Prepare and submit required forms to initiate vendor compliance processes
Tenant & Operational Support
- Act as a key point of contact for tenants, ensuring smooth communication and support
- Assist with specialty leasing activations and center events
- Support general administrative needs that keep the center running efficiently
